A prime example of this would be in Cambridge, Massachusetts, where putting ideology over common sense recently claimed another victim.

Department of Public Works employee Xavier Bautista was found dead on July 4; his body was spotted by a pedestrian early in the morning.

“Bautista was found between a parked vehicle and the curb and pronounced dead at the scene,” CBS Boston reported. “His cause of death was determined to be two gunshot wounds.”

Bautista had been shot over an hour earlier. And that’s where the outrage comes in.

Not long ago, a ShotSpotter device that tracks gunshot sounds would have notified police about the shooting. Bautista could have received immediate medical attention and there’s a good chance he might have lived.

But the device wasn’t on.

In fact, ShotSpotter has been abandoned throughout the city.

Community members are understandably outraged and demanding answers.

The answer wasn’t hard to find.

Thanks to the infinite wisdom of the Cambridge City Council, ShotSpotter was shut down after it voted to remove the system in May. The effort was led by the socialist councilor Ayah A. Al-Zubi, who said the technology poses a “privacy and safety” risk for residents.
